Transaction 6376b26c94a7a75246d70b4be32636284f473bfbd6604c04e3df47d844aff539
1 Input
1 Output
-
6376b26c94a7a75246d70b4be32636284f473bfbd6604c04e3df47d844aff539:0
- value
- 41377
- script pubkey
- OP_0 OP_PUSHBYTES_20 17616009ed7e722ee142bb31c99016a94f5ce77b
- address
- bc1qzaskqz0d0eezac2zhvcunyqk4984eemm63vmfg